1. 网络数据传输:libcurl库可以用于在C++程序中进行网络数据传输,包括HTTP、FTP、SMTP等协议的数据传输。 2. Web爬虫:利用libcurl库可以编写Web爬虫程序,从网页中抓...
要在C++中使用libcurl库,首先需要包含相应的头文件,并链接对应的库文件。接下来可以使用libcurl提供的功能来进行网络请求,例如发送HTTP请求、下载文件等。 以下是一个简单的示例代码,演...
1. 支持多种协议:libcurl库支持包括HTTP、FTP、SMTP、POP3等在内的多种协议,可以方便地进行网络通信和数据传输。 2. 跨平台性:libcurl库是一个跨平台的库,可以在多个操作...
要在Ubuntu上安装libcurl库,可以使用以下步骤:1. 打开终端。2. 运行以下命令更新软件包列表:```sudo apt update```3. 运行以下命令安装libcurl库:```su...